upvc window repairs windows can have problems opening or locking. This problem usually occurs when the locking mechanism is stiff or jammed. It is possible to lubricate the lock and handle using graphite or machine oil. This will allow the mechanism to be unlocked and the window or door to function normally once again.

Another issue that often arises with uPVC windows is that the hinges can become stiff or even stuck. This problem is usually caused by grit and dust building up on the hinges. The solution is to lubricate the hinges with oil or grease. The wrong type of lubricant could harm the hinges, rendering them unusable.

Stained Glass Repairs

Stained glass windows can be found in homes, churches and other structures. They add visual interest, privacy and light to a space. They can be fragile and require regular maintenance to ensure they remain in good shape. Even with the best maintenance, stained and leaded glass windows deteriorate over time due to age and exposure to weather and other environmental elements. This causes a range of issues, including cracks, fade and water leakage. If you own a stained or leaded glass window that needs repair, it's important to find an expert in your area who can restore the piece to its original splendor.

On average, the cost of repair of broken or cracked stained glass is approximately $500. The exact price will depend on the type of solution needed to solve the issue. A professional might use copper foil or epoxy edge-gluing to repair the broken glasses. They can also relead lead cames and reseal stained glass. There are many alternatives, each with distinct advantages and costs. The choice of the best solution will depend on the size of the crack, the location and the type of material used in the production of the glass.

imageCracks in the leaded glass can be caused by thermal expansion, vibrations or contraction, building movements, or just normal wear and tear. Cracks can grow larger and cause more problems over time. To prevent further damage and growth any crack that crosses the face of stained-glass panels or their face must be repaired as soon as is possible. In the past, this was done by cutting a "Dutchman's" lead flange onto the crack. This method was not a great solution, and today there are much better methods to repair these kinds of cracks.

Stained glass restoration is a specialized art that can take many forms. It can be as easy as fixing a crack or as complex as making a stained glass door panel or window back to its original state. In general, the cost of a complete restoration is much higher than an easy repair. This is due to the fact that the process involves cleaning and removing damaged or stained glass, securing the lead cames, resealing and re-tying cement and replacing missing pieces of stained glass.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ping prevents air and water from entering homes through gaps that surround windows and doors. It's a crucial part of home maintenance and can reduce the need for expensive repairs or energy bills, as as make a home more comfortable. The materials used in the construction of this seal can deteriorate with time, as a result of wear and tear. It is essential to replace these materials periodically.

You can determine the weather stripping is been damaged by noticing a spot that is wet after washing the windows, a whistling sound while driving, or a draft that you can feel when you are in front of a closed-door. These are all signs that it's time for a Tasker who can provide weatherstripping repair near me.

Taskers can protect your doors and windows by using a variety of weatherstripping materials. Foam tapes are made of open-cell or closed cell foam. They come in different sizes, thicknesses, and widths. They are easy to put in and can be cut using scissors. Felt strips are inexpensive and last for at least a year. You can cut them to size using scissors, and then attach them to the frame of your door or hinge side of the sliding windows using staples, glue, or tacks. Metal or vinyl V-strips are somewhat more difficult to install but they can be nailed into place along a window jamb.
